A 10 panel drug test is among the most comprehensive drug screening options currently available, offering a broader detection range compared to standard panels. This test is specifically designed to detect both common and less frequently abused substances. While a standard 5 panel drug test primarily screens for marijuana, cocaine, opiates, amphetamines, and PCP, the 10 panel test extends its scope significantly.
The 10 panel drug test enhances the basic screening by including five additional drug categories: benzodiazepines, barbiturates, methadone, propoxyphene, and Quaaludes (methaqualone). This expansion allows for a more comprehensive assessment, providing insights into a wider variety of substance use. This makes it particularly valuable for safety-sensitive industries where thorough evaluations are crucial.
Employers, particularly those in safety-sensitive fields, often utilize 10 panel drug tests to ensure that their workforce is free from both common and less commonly abused substances. This comprehensive approach assists in maintaining reliable and safe operations, reducing the risk of accidents and ensuring a productive work environment.

10 Panel Lab Based Test vs. 10 Panel Instant Test
Understand the differences - speed vs. defensibility - so you can choose the right 10 panel drug test option for employment, court, and personal testing.
Both options screen the same 10 drug classes (THC, cocaine, opiates, amphetamines/methamphetamine, PCP, benzodiazepines, barbiturates, methadone, propoxyphene, and Quaaludes*). The difference is how results are produced, verified, and used.
*Methaqualone only available in urine lab-based testing
10 Panel Lab based vs. 10 Panel Instant Drug Test
Feature | 10 Panel Lab-Based | 10 Panel Instant (POCT) |
---|---|---|
Primary Use | Employment, legal/court, policy-driven programs | Rapid on-site screening; same-day hiring decisions |
Specimen | Urine (standard); hair/oral fluid/nail options | Urine (most common) |
Speed | Negatives 1 business day after lab receipt; non-negatives 2-3 days with MRO | Screen results in 5-10 minutes (presumptive) |
Accuracy & Confirmation | High; confirmatory GC/MS or LC-MS/MS on any non-negative | Screening only; non-negatives should be lab-confirmed |
MRO Review | Yes (on non-negative lab results) | Not by default; added when sending to lab |
Chain of Custody (CCF) | End-to-end documented | Used for screen; lab CCF applies if sent for confirmation |
Legal Defensibility | Strong (SAMHSA-certified lab + confirmation + MRO) | Limited until confirmed by a lab |
Compliance | Meets most employer/court policies; DOT uses lab-based 5-panel | Great for rapid screens; policies often require confirmation for final action |
Cost Profile | Higher unit price; includes confirmation/MRO when needed | Lower upfront; confirmation adds cost/time on non-negatives |

Order 10 Panel Instant10 Panel Drug Test Detection Times
Windows are driven by drug metabolism and specimen type, not whether testing is lab-based or instant. Urine is standard for both; alternative specimens are typically lab-based.
Specimen | Typical Detection Window | Best Use |
---|---|---|
Urine | 1-7 days (THC up to 30) | Employment, legal, personal |
Hair | Up to 90 days | History/patterns of use |
Oral Fluid (Saliva) | 24-72 hours | Recent use; post-accident/suspicion |
Blood | Hours to 2-3 days | Very recent use |
Nails | 3-6 months | Extended look-back |
Compliance Notes
- DOT programs require a lab-based 5-panel under 49 CFR Part 40 (not a 10 panel).
- Many employer/court policies require lab confirmation + MRO review for final actions.
- On-site instant testing may require appropriate CLIA credentials depending on device and state rules.

What Does a 10 Panel Drug Test Detect?
- Marijuana (THC)
- Cocaine
- Opiates (morphine, codeine, heroin)
- Amphetamines (incl. methamphetamine)
- Phencyclidine (PCP)
- Benzodiazepines
- Barbiturates
- Methadone
- Propoxyphene
- Quaaludes (methaqualone) (available in lab-based testing only)

10 Panel Drug Testing in Kincaid, IL
Kincaid, Illinois is a small village located in Christian County, offering a glimpse into charming rural life in the state. With a tight-knit community atmosphere, Kincaid is home to just over 1,400 residents, as per recent estimates. The village provides a quiet, peaceful environment with numerous local businesses catering to the needs of its population.
Geographically, Kincaid is nestled amid the picturesque landscapes of central Illinois, providing residents and visitors with scenic views and outdoor opportunities. The village's landscape is characterized by open fields, lush farmlands, and proximity to beautiful lakes and parks, ideal for recreational activities.
The economy of Kincaid is primarily driven by local agriculture and small businesses, reflecting the traditional values of the region. This economic structure supports the community ethos and contributes to a stable lifestyle for its residents. Additionally, Kincaid hosts various community events throughout the year, strengthening the bonds among its residents.
Education is a key focus in Kincaid, with local schools being part of the South Fork School District. These institutions are dedicated to providing quality education and fostering the academic and personal growth of students. Community involvement and support play a significant role in the functioning of these schools.
While Kincaid is relatively small, its close proximity to larger cities like Springfield allows residents to access a wider range of services and amenities, including medical care, shopping centers, and cultural events. This balance of small-town charm and urban convenience makes Kincaid an appealing place to live.
Demographically, Kincaid represents a typical Midwestern village with a majority of its population being Caucasian, along with small representations from other ethnic groups. The village places great importance on the sense of community, often seen in local gatherings and communal activities.
Overall, Kincaid's strong sense of heritage and tradition, combined with its rural charm and accessibility, make it a unique place within Illinois. It embodies a mix of historical significance and modern-day amenities, making it a welcoming community for both long-term residents and newcomers alike.
